bunglebus Posted March 25, 2020 Share Posted March 25, 2020 I really rate Wilko paint but it's not the cheapest. Poundland normally only do black, white and grey primer, but I have had red primer, metallic pink, metallic green, two different silvers etc out of them when they've had it.
